There is no better story of business success and how to reach it than the story about Rajesh Bothra
, Mumbai born Indian who as only 16 year old decided to quit his studies and start his own business.
Rajesh Bothra was born 1968 in a Marwari family whose roots come from a Rajaldesar village in Rajasthan. His tip on how to succeed in business is to be fearless, always ready for all kinds of problems on your road and never to give up your dreams embracing every opportunity. Such thinking brought him where he is today, to become CEO of Kobain, a top IT company with over S$300 million yearly turnover. Kobain's brand Mercury is the reason this company today standing side by side with companies such are Intel, IBM and Compaq.
After realizing that India isn't the best place to run the business because of the number of problems that businessmen in India meet daily, Rajesh found better ground in Singapore and decided 1991 after marrying to move his business and his home there. Singapore seemed as a better option than Hong Kong and Dubai because of similarity in culture and way of life with life he use to have in India.
After moving to Singapore it took only one year to become equal partner with Mr. Nikhil Shah, owner of Kobain which was already well established IT company in Singapore those days. Shortly after that they expanded the company and today company has offices in 12 cities around the world and three factories where they produce motherboards, keyboards, power supplies, DVD players, monitors and so much more. The product range is huge and that is why there are no competitors on the market yet. Their products are sold under brand Mercury and well known around the globe. There is over 160 products and over 300 models which are sold across the US, Middle East, Europe and India.
Kobain has three factories, two in India and one in China but their plan is to build one more factory in Eastern Europe and it will be in Polland or Czechoslovakia. Products sale varies from country to country and in India products are sold directly to distributors while in US products go to merchants. Products in the Middle East are sold through dealers. Sale of Mercury products Kobian operates from Singapore through its 12 offices around the globe.

Rajesh's father died 11 years ago and mother only 4 years after his father. They always encouraged him and supported his ideas and plans. Since their death his biggest support in work and life is his wife Rashmi who also gave him two children, son Harsha who is 13 and daughter Divya who is 10. The whole family is very attached to India and people there and that is why
Rajesh is trying to help poor people in India giving provision of his annual profit to feed over 20,000 people. At the moment food from his charity centers is given in 20 cities across India and his plan is to spread that charity work to Cambodia and Africa and offer help and food to poor and hungry people in that area.
